Responsibilities We are seeking to hire a qualified Technical Designer with experience in model-based erection procedure deliverables for various structural systems, as well as fabrication-level (LOD400) detailing for structural steel, reinforced concrete, and light gauge steel structural systems. The role of Technical Designer in the Construction Engineering practice area is to develop Building Information Models (BIM), engineering elements, and structural systems specifically during construction phase portions of projects. Position requires impeccable written and spoken communication skills with frequent interactions with architects, contractors, and owners. Other responsibilities include:
Uses latest tools/digital workflows to efficiently create and maintain BIM information and to interoperate with analysis, documentation, fabrication, and construction models
Performs clash detection against reference models and works with internal team to track and resolve clashes and conflicts
Works with project team (architects, contractors, engineers, designers, and modelers) to plan and document project-specific digital implementation, including analysis, design, documentation, fabrication, and construction models
Audits models after key milestones, and periodically checks model content for accuracy, consistency, and adherence to graphic and modeling standards
Understands key building systems, their components, and typical layout/geometry/dimensions
Learns detailing conventions for commonly encountered conditions and project-specific details
Works towards understanding of constructability issues, especially with atypical conditions
